Match Summary
Chornomorets defeated Hirnyk 3:2. The match was played in Premier League 2022. Goals were scored by D. Alefirenko 40′, M. Zaderaka 58′, M. Lunev 62′, O. Kuzyk 66′, D. Alefirenko 76′. 3 yellow cards were shown. Hirnyk had 51% possession while Chornomorets held 49%. Hirnyk had 13 shots (4 on target) compared to 10 (5 on target) for Chornomorets. Hirnyk made 2 substitutions, Chornomorets made 2.
